Personal Experiences with Rich and Regular Men
I vividly recall dating a millionaire in my 20s, someone twice my age. Despite our numerous similarities and his kindness, the dates were limited due to my perception of his future compatibility. While he was extraordinarily generous and gentle, his personal challenges created insightful reflections on what living with someone like him might entail.
On the flip side, I have also been in relationships with regular guys. These experiences highlighted the realities of everyday challenges, character development, and personal growth. The key factor in staying or leaving was not the financial status but rather the person’s character. This experience taught me a valuable lesson: money does not equate to happiness.
